Which of the following is a major challenge for the Indian economy?
A. Absence of informal sector
B. Complete self-sufficiency in all goods
C. High level of human development across all states equally
D. Regional disparities and unemployment
Answer: Option D
Solution (By JKSSB Mock Tests)
Regional disparities in development and persistent unemployment (especially youth and disguised unemployment) remain significant challenges for the Indian economy.

Which of the following is a feature of the 'Uncovered Interest Parity' puzzle or forward-premium puzzle?
A. Forward rates are perfect predictors of future spot rates
B. Interest differentials are always zero
C. High-interest currencies always depreciate as predicted
D. High-interest currencies tend to appreciate rather than depreciate as uncovered interest parity would predict

Correct Answer: Option D


Explanation:
Empirical evidence often shows that currencies with high interest rates tend to appreciate, contrary to the prediction of uncovered interest parity that they should depreciate; this is known as the forward-premium puzzle.

Which of the following is a feature of the monopolistic competition market structure?
A. Product differentiation and selling costs
B. Homogeneous product
C. Single seller
D. Perfect knowledge and no advertising

Correct Answer: Option A


Explanation:
Monopolistic competition is characterised by product differentiation, a large number of firms, free entry and exit, and significant selling costs.
